Factors Affecting Door Hinge Repair Costs
A number of aspects contribute to the general cost of door hinge repair. Understanding these elements can help property owners prepare for expenses successfully.
Kind of Door: The kind of door (interior, exterior, durable, or ornamental) significantly affects the cost. Outside doors, for example, are generally much heavier and can need more robust hinges.
Hinge Type: There are different types of hinges, including butt hinges, continuous hinges, and pivot hinges. Each type has its pricing and installation requirements.
Product Quality: The material of the hinges can differ from standard steel to stainless-steel or even brass. Higher-quality materials frequently feature a higher price.
Labor Costs: Hiring a professional to repair or replace hinges will considerably affect the total cost. Labor rates can fluctuate based on area and provider.
Degree of Damage: Minor misalignment may just need adjustment, while serious rust or wear might require complete hinge replacement. The level of the damage will considerably impact repair expenses.
Ease of access: If the door remains in a hard-to-reach location or requires unique tools for repair, the labor costs might increase.
Location: The geographical area also plays a significant function in identifying repair expenses, as costs for products and labor can vary extensively.
Typical Door Hinge Repair Costs
The typical costs associated with door hinge repairs can be broken down into numerous categories:
Service TypeAverage Cost RangeHinge Adjustment₤ 40 - ₤ 100Hinge Replacement (Standard)₤ 50 - ₤ 150Sturdy Door Hinge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 300Industrial Door Hinge Repair₤ 150 - ₤ 400Breakdown of Common Services
Hinge Adjustment: This is a relatively easy procedure where the hinges are straightened. Property owners can expect to pay between ₤ 40 and ₤ 100 for this service.
Standard Hinge Replacement: If the hinges are worn out and require replacement, the cost can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, depending on the type and material.
Sturdy Door Hinge Replacement: For outside doors or much heavier systems, replacement hinges can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 due to their increased size and strength.
Industrial Door Hinge Repair: Repairing hinges on commercial doors can be more pricey, often between ₤ 150 and ₤ 400, reflecting the requirement for more specialized labor and materials.

Signs that your door hinges requirement attention include problem in opening or closing the door, visible rust or corrosion on the hinges, and unequal gaps around the door frame.
2. Can I replace door hinges myself?
Yes, replacing door hinges can be a DIY job if you have the necessary tools and some fundamental handyman abilities. However, for those unpleasant with home repairs, employing a professional is a good idea.
3. The length of time does it require to repair door hinges?
The time required for door hinge repair can differ. An adjustment might take as low as 30 minutes, while a total replacement could take 1-2 hours.
